samsung 80/32 GB x DMA :(

karpi karpi.lists na email.cz
Pondělí Leden 10 18:40:01 CET 2005


Zdravím všechny diskaře mezi vámi..
.. mám problém, že mi nejde zapnout DMA pro disk.. (kernl 2.6). Deska 
Asus P5-a (.. dá se tohle zjistit nějakym příkazem?) + o něco novější 
disk Samsung 80GB - ten se nenašel, tak jsem ho přeswitchoval na 32GB. 
Nevím, jestli to souvisí, radši to sem píšu. Jako 32GB se našel, 
bootuje, funguje, vidí ho tak i fdisk. Akorát nejsem schopen pro něj 
zprovoznit DMA (takže vlastne nefunguje).

root # uname -r
2.6.7-gentoo-r11

root # cat /proc/ide/hda/model
SAMSUNG SP0802N

root # lspci
0000:00:00.0 Host bridge: ALi Corporation M1541 (rev 04)
0000:00:01.0 PCI bridge: ALi Corporation M1541 PCI to AGP Controller 
(rev 04)
0000:00:03.0 Bridge: ALi Corporation M7101 PMU
0000:00:07.0 ISA bridge: ALi Corporation M1533 PCI to ISA Bridge 
[Aladdin IV] (rev c3)
0000:00:0f.0 IDE interface: ALi Corporation M5229 IDE (rev c1)
0000:01:00.0 VGA compatible controller: Matrox Graphics, Inc. MGA G400 
AGP (rev 04)

root # hdparm -t /dev/hda

/dev/hda:
  Timing buffered disk reads:    8 MB in  4.07 seconds =   1.97 MB/sec

root # hdparm -d /dev/hda

/dev/hda:
  using_dma    =  0 (off)
root # hdparm -d1  /dev/hda

/dev/hda:
  setting using_dma to 1 (on)
  HDIO_SET_DMA failed: Operation not permitted
  using_dma    =  0 (off)

		 Díky za jakoukoli radu či vysvětlení..







Další informace o konferenci Linux